I guess this is partly the impact of the change in work permit rules increasing the difficulty of bringing in players from abroad (not intending to start a debate on Brexit).Another place I hope we look are those that stepped up to the Championship last season but didn’t get the game time they were after. Carlos Mendes Gomes at Luton for example. Went from Morecambe in L2, early 20s and one of the many names some hoped we would sign last summer.
Of course I have doubts about our scouting setup like the majority do but we should at least be looking at a wider pool of players than we have in the last few years. Gallen was on his own before TS came in and it sounded like he was at times signing players suggested by agents. Names like Watson, Gunter, Souare, Arter etc coming in didn’t suggest we had a solid list of potential signings and some of those were only last summer.
The big question is can we pick out the right players, not just ability but personality. With older players including Pearce and Watson going we probably need a few more experienced leaders in the squad.
I hope they don’t push the finding value and potential too far and leave us lacking players like that in the squad. We did that in 15/16 under RD, leaving us with too many younger players who needed time we didn’t have to develop, some from our academy and others from abroad. We might not have got relegated had we had more proven Championship players and fewer young players - the danger is overrating what the latter are capable of when several of them play together.3 -
